However, as you rely more on wearables for tracking your health, questions about data privacy inevitably come up. Your device collects a vast amount of information about your activity, heart rate, sleep patterns, and more. While this data helps create an all-encompassing picture of your fitness journey, it also raises concerns about who has access to it and how it’s used. You need to be aware of the privacy policies tied to your device and the app ecosystem. Manufacturers and app developers often share data with third parties or use it for targeted advertising, which can feel intrusive. Being mindful of these issues helps you make informed choices about the devices you trust with your personal health information.

How Accurate Are Wearable Devices in Tracking Health Data?

Wearable devices are generally quite accurate, but data accuracy can vary depending on sensor reliability and device quality. You might find some inconsistencies with heart rate or step count, especially during intense activity. However, most high-quality wearables provide reliable data for daily health tracking. To get the best results, choose devices with proven sensor reliability and regularly calibrate or update your wearables to guarantee accurate health data collection.

What Privacy Concerns Are Associated With Wearable Fitness Devices?

You should be aware that wearable fitness devices pose privacy concerns, especially regarding data security and personal privacy. When you use these devices, your health data gets stored and transmitted, which could be vulnerable to hacking or unauthorized access. It’s important to read privacy policies and choose devices with strong security measures. Staying informed helps protect your personal information and guarantees your data remains private and secure.
